The automotive wiper market is segmented by product type, primarily into conventional bracket blades and the more advanced beam blades. Conventional bracket blades, characterized by a metal frame that holds the rubber wiping element, have been the traditional standard for decades. However, beam blades are increasingly gaining market share due to their superior performance characteristics. Beam blades feature a one-piece, frameless design that exerts even pressure across the entire windshield, leading to a cleaner wipe and better performance in various weather conditions, including ice and snow. Their aerodynamic shape also reduces wind lift and noise at high speeds, enhancing driver comfort. Another emerging type includes hybrid blades, which combine elements of both designs. The choice between types is influenced by factors such as vehicle model, climatic conditions, and consumer preference for performance versus cost. The ongoing trend is a clear shift towards beam and smart blades, driven by consumer demand for higher quality and OEMs incorporating them as standard or premium options in new vehicles.
Application insights for the automotive wiper market reveal its segmentation across different vehicle types, principally passenger cars and commercial vehicles. The passenger car segment represents the largest application area, consuming the highest volume of wiper systems. This is attributable to the massive global production and ownership of passenger vehicles, where wipers are a mandatory safety component. Within this segment, demand varies from basic systems in economy models to advanced rain-sensing and heated wipers in luxury vehicles. The commercial vehicle application, which includes trucks, buses, and off-road equipment, is also a significant contributor to the market. Wiper systems for commercial vehicles are often designed to be more robust and durable to withstand harsh operating conditions and larger windshield areas. Furthermore, specialized applications exist, such as in trains, aircraft, and marine vessels, though these constitute niche segments. The automotive wiper market is dominated by a group of leading international companies known for their innovation, quality, and global reach. Robert Bosch GmbH is a foremost player, renowned for its comprehensive range of wiper blades and systems, including its iconic Aerotwin beam blades. Valeo Group is another major contender, offering advanced solutions such as its AquaBlade technology, which integrates a washing system within the blade itself. Denso Corporation, a key Japanese supplier, provides high-quality wiper systems to numerous automakers and has a strong presence in the aftermarket. MITSUBA Corporation is also a significant player, known for its wiper motors and complete systems. In North America, Trico Products is a historically important manufacturer with a strong brand recognition. These companies compete on the basis of product innovation, technology, durability, and their ability to secure long-term supply contracts with global automotive OEMs. Their strategies often include heavy investment in research and development to create more efficient and intelligent wiper systems.

What are the different types of automotive wiper blades?
The primary types are conventional bracket blades, which use a metal frame, and beam blades, which are frameless and exert even pressure for superior performance in all conditions.
How do rain-sensing wipers work?
Rain-sensing wipers use an optical sensor typically located near the rearview mirror that detects moisture on the windshield. The system automatically activates the wipers and adjusts their speed based on the intensity of the rainfall.
What is the lifespan of typical wiper blades?
The lifespan varies based on material quality, usage frequency, and environmental conditions, but most manufacturers recommend replacing standard rubber wiper blades every six to twelve months for optimal performance and safety.
